From the Protection/Volume Relationships page, you can remove a protection relationship to permanently delete an existing relationship between the selected source and destination: for example, when you want to create a relationship using a different destination. This operation removes all metadata and cannot be undone.
Before you begin
-
You must have the OnCommand Administrator or Storage Administrator role.
-
You must have set up Workflow Automation.
Steps
-
From the Protection/Volume Relationships page, select one or more volumes with protection relationships you want to remove and, on the toolbar, click Remove.
The Remove Relationship dialog box is displayed.
-
Click Continue to remove the relationship.
The relationship is removed from the Protection/Volume Relationships page.
